Abstract
Sensors, actuators or physical components in engineering systems are often subjected to un-permitted or unexpected deviations from usual operating conditions. With a relatively small computing effort and with good results to unmeasured disturbances, the parity equations build for a specific process are proven to be very useful to provide fault detection residuals in order to identify the fault.
